Lance Crouther Biography
Lance Crouther is an American television producer, television writer, and actor. He is best known for his work as the head writer of the TBS late-night show Lopez Tonight until 2010. As a writer, Crouther has contributed to various television shows including Down to Earth, Wanda at Large, and Good Hair. He also co-wrote the documentary screenplay for Good Hair, receiving a nomination for the Writers Guild of America Award. Additionally, Crouther has appeared as an actor in several projects, most notably starring in the feature film Pootie Tang. He has made appearances on shows such as Lights Out with David Spade, Saturday Night Live, and Everybody Hates Chris.
